He feels it's much too soon
  He never wanted to visit spain
Some say that it's sunny over there
But he thinks it's all an illusion.

And his country is as cold as ice
He shivers to keep warm
And spain looks so good
But fear keeps him here

He stays a little while longer
Air travel is much to risky when you're not in control
Maybe he'll go skiing tomorrow morning
and let spain choose him instead.

I'm sorry if I read more into this than intended (but if you're happy with that then great).

I saw this largely as an explanation for why people believe that things are planned out, why people believe in fate: because of fear. This is brought out by the final decision to 'let spain choose him instead'. It's the person who wants to improve his life but instead of actively improving it he tells himself that if things are supposed to get better they will, purely from fear of the unknown.

While writing that and re-reading I also have to wonder about spain. Is it here used to represent heaven and this man's contemplation of death? He decides to let spain (heaven or death) choose him for fear of not knowing what happens when he dies.

My other reading of this was that it's simply about the grass being greener somewhere else. I feel as if there is another man, sitting in 'spain' and wanting to go somewhere cold to go skiing.

One technical point, in the final stanza it should be 'too risky' rather than 'to risky'. I can't decide if you intentionally left 'spain' without a capital letter or not but I'll leave that one to you.
